Lutron Timer Switch for Bathroom Fan: A Guide to Silent, Efficient Ventilation
Bathroom ventilation is crucial for preventing mold, mildew, and musty odors. A reliable exhaust fan is key, but adding a Lutron timer switch elevates its functionality, saving energy and extending the lifespan of your fan. This comprehensive guide explores the benefits, installation process, and troubleshooting tips for using a Lutron timer switch with your bathroom fan.
Why Choose a Lutron Timer Switch for Your Bathroom Fan?
Lutron is a renowned name in lighting and home automation, known for its quality and innovative solutions. Their timer switches offer several advantages over standard timers or simple on/off switches:
- Energy Savings: A Lutron timer automatically shuts off the fan after a pre-set duration, preventing unnecessary energy consumption. This is particularly beneficial in bathrooms where the fan is often left running longer than needed.
- Extended Fan Lifespan: Reducing the on-time of your bathroom fan minimizes wear and tear on the motor, leading to a longer lifespan and potentially saving you money on replacements.
- Quiet Operation: Lutron switches are known for their quiet operation, unlike some cheaper timers that can produce noticeable clicking or humming sounds. A quiet bathroom fan is essential for a peaceful home environment.
- Easy Installation: While some electrical work is involved, Lutron timer switches are designed for relatively easy installation, even for DIY enthusiasts with basic electrical knowledge.
- Various Timer Options: Lutron offers a range of timer switches with different functionalities, allowing you to choose the perfect fit for your needs. Options include adjustable run times and even occupancy sensors for automatic operation.
- Improved Aesthetics: Lutron switches often have a more sleek and modern design compared to standard timer switches, enhancing the overall appearance of your bathroom.
Choosing the Right Lutron Timer Switch
Before purchasing, consider the following factors:
- Type of Fan: Ensure the switch's amperage rating is compatible with your bathroom fan's requirements. Check your fan's specifications for this crucial information. Never use a switch with a lower amperage rating than your fan demands.
- Timer Settings: Decide on the desired run time. Lutron offers options ranging from a few minutes to longer durations, allowing for customization based on your bathroom's ventilation needs.
- Installation Type: Consider whether you need a single-pole or three-way switch, depending on the wiring configuration in your bathroom.
- Features: Explore additional features such as dimming capabilities (if your fan allows it) or integration with Lutron's smart home ecosystem.
Installing a Lutron Timer Switch for Your Bathroom Fan: A Step-by-Step Guide
Disclaimer: Electrical work can be dangerous. If you're uncomfortable working with electricity, consult a qualified electrician. Always turn off the power at the breaker before beginning any electrical work.
- Turn Off the Power: Locate the circuit breaker controlling your bathroom fan and switch it to the "off" position.
- Remove the Old Switch: Unscrew the old switch plate and carefully remove the switch from the electrical box.
- Wire the New Switch: Carefully follow the wiring diagram included with your Lutron timer switch. This usually involves connecting the wires from the power source, the fan, and the switch according to the color-coded instructions.
- Secure the Switch: Once the wiring is complete, carefully tuck the wires back into the electrical box and secure the new Lutron timer switch in place.
- Test the Switch: Turn the power back on at the breaker and test the timer switch. Make sure the fan turns on and off as expected at the programmed intervals.
Troubleshooting Common Issues
- Fan Doesn't Turn On: Double-check the wiring connections and ensure the power is turned on at the breaker.
- Timer Doesn't Work: Refer to the Lutron timer switch's instructions for programming and troubleshooting. Some models may require a specific sequence to set the timer correctly.
- Fan Runs Continuously: This could indicate a faulty timer switch or a problem with the wiring. Consult the troubleshooting section of your manual or call Lutron customer support.
